About Holbox

The most decorated seafood counter in the city is a market stall inside Mercado La Paloma. Michelin-starred, no tablecloths, no alcohol. The menu rotates daily based on what's fresh from Baja, the Gulf, and local boats: bluefin tuna ceviches, kanpachi tostadas, spot prawn aguachiles, all on nixtamalized heirloom corn from Oaxaca. Reservations drop the first of every month and vanish in minutes.

What to order at Holbox

  • Spot Prawn & Scallop Aguachile

    $36

    Santa Barbara spot prawns and Baja scallops in spicy green aguachile — limited, order first.

  • Tostada de Kanpachi & Uni

    $24

    Kanpachi ceviche tostada topped with 20g Santa Barbara uni — the decadent move at $24.

  • Ceviche de Atun

    $28

    Baja California bluefin tuna ceviche — the signature starter, precisely seasoned.
